Sharwanand’s latest film Biker has registered a respectable start at the box office, collecting ₹18.09 crore worldwide during its first weekend. The film managed to draw audiences across domestic and overseas markets, giving it a decent opening.
Steady Weekend Performance
Released with moderate expectations, Biker witnessed gradual growth over the first three days. The film saw improved occupancy during the weekend, especially in urban centres where youth audiences showed interest in the sports-based storyline.
The movie’s unique motocross theme and emotional elements helped it attract a section of moviegoers, contributing to the steady collections during the opening weekend.
Positive Response Helps Collections
The film received a mixed-to-positive response from audiences, with appreciation for Sharwanand’s performance and the racing sequences. These factors helped the movie maintain momentum over the weekend.
Trade observers believe that while the opening numbers are encouraging, the film needs to hold steady during weekdays to strengthen its box-office prospects.
